Bio/Interests:

Alison Weber was born and raised in Connecticut. She received a BA in Humanities with a minor in Mathematic from Providence College in 2001. Alison spent two years with the AmeriCorps*VISTA program at the Community & Economic Development Office (CEDO)in Burlington, Vermont prior to enrolling in the CDAE graduate program. She is currently working with Burlington Community Land Trust on the benefits of affordable rental and co-op housing. Her research interests include community planning, civic engagement, and local leadership.
